Weather in May

May, the last month of the autumn in Amaguana, is another mild month, with temperature in the range of an average high of 14.8°C (58.6°F) and an average low of 6.6°C (43.9°F).

Temperature

Entering May, the average high-temperature is recorded at a still mild 14.8°C (58.6°F), exhibiting a minimal shift from April's 14.5°C (58.1°F). In the month of May, Amaguana's average low-temperature falls to a frosty 6.6°C (43.9°F).

Humidity

In Amaguana, the average relative humidity in May is 87%.

Rainfall

In Amaguana, during May, the rain falls for 27.8 days and regularly aggregates up to 140mm (5.51") of prec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 295.6 rainfall days, and 1528mm (60.16") of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

January through December are months with snowfall. In Amaguana, during May, snow falls for 0.4 days and regularly aggregates up to 9mm (0.35") of snow. In Amaguana, during the entire year, snow falls for 9.6 days and aggregates up to 147mm (5.79") of snow.

Daylight

In May, the average length of the day is 12h and 6min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 06:07 and sunset at 18:14. On the last day of May, sunrise is at 06:08 and sunset at 18:14 -05.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in May is 7.2h.
